Ways To Make Advertising Your Business More Affordable

Date:

Advertising is the lifeblood of any successful business. However, it can be an expensive endeavor for startups and small businesses with limited budgets. To help you achieve your advertising goals without breaking the bank, we’ve compiled a list of creative ways to pay for your advertising campaigns.

Barter with Media Outlets

Instead of paying cash, consider bartering with media outlets. Offer your products or services in exchange for ad space. This can be a win-win situation, allowing you to save money and gain exposure for your business.

Use Co-op Advertising

Co-op advertising is when manufacturers and retailers work together to promote a product. The manufacturer provides financial support for the retailer’s advertising while the retailer focuses on promoting the product. This allows both parties to share the cost of advertising, making it more affordable.

Take Advantage of Social Media

Social media platforms offer cost-effective ways to reach your target audience. Engage with your followers, create compelling content, and run ads to boost visibility. Many platforms also offer budget-friendly ad options to help you stretch your advertising dollars further.

Utilize Content Marketing

Content marketing involves creating valuable, relevant content to attract and engage your target audience. By offering useful information, you can establish your brand as an industry expert and drive traffic to your website. Publish blog posts, create videos, or host webinars to promote your brand without spending a fortune on advertising.

Try Affiliate Marketing

Affiliate marketing is a performance-based advertising model where you pay others to promote your products or services. Affiliates earn a commission for each sale or lead they generate. This method helps you reach a wider audience without the upfront costs associated with traditional advertising.

Collaborate with Influencers

Influencer marketing involves partnering with individuals with a significant social media following. These influencers can endorse your products or services, helping you reach a larger audience. This strategy can be more cost-effective than traditional advertising, as influencers charge less than media outlets.

Host a Giveaway or Contest

Hosting a giveaway or contest is a great way to generate buzz around your brand. Offer prizes for your products or services, and encourage participants to share your contest on social media. This will help increase your reach and brand awareness without a huge financial investment.

Offer Free Workshops or Seminars

Organizing free workshops or seminars can attract potential customers and showcase your expertise. Invite industry experts to speak and promote the event through local media and social platforms. You can indirectly advertise your business and generate leads by providing value to attendees.

Explore Guerilla Marketing Tactics

Guerilla marketing involves unconventional, low-cost strategies to promote your business. This can include street art, flash mobs, or publicity stunts. These tactics often create a buzz, attracting media attention and increasing your brand visibility without a substantial investment.

Utilize Local Sponsorships

Sponsoring local events, sports teams, or charities can help you gain exposure within your community. You’ll typically receive advertising space or opportunities to promote your business at the event in exchange for your support. This can be a cost-effective way to increase brand awareness and build goodwill.

Leverage Email Marketing

Email marketing is an affordable way to engage customers and promote your products or services. Develop a targeted email list, create personalized content, and track your results to optimize your campaigns. With the right strategy, you can achieve a high return on investment.

Partner with Other Businesses

Collaborating with complementary businesses can help you share advertising costs and expand your reach. Joint promotions, cross-promotions, or bundled deals can attract new customers and generate buzz. Both businesses can benefit from increased visibility and a broader audience by working together.

Paying for advertising doesn’t have to be a financial burden. With ingenuity and resourcefulness, you can reach your target audience and grow your brand on a budget.
